About This Role

The Department of Finance in the Kansas State University College of Business is seeking applications for a non-tenure track, full-time Visiting Assistant Professor of Finance anticipated to start August 2026 with a one-year appointment. The candidate will be primarily responsible for teaching and service activities in the College of Business, with resources available to continue their research activities.

Teaching: The desired area of teaching expertise is investments. The individual selected will teach investment courses as a regular part of their teaching assignment anticipated to be two sections in the fall semester and two sections in the spring semester. In addition, the individual should be able to teach in a supplementary area such as corporate finance or financial modeling.

Service: The individual selected will also be expected to demonstrate a commitment to collegiality and shared governance. As a part of this role, the individual will undertake service for the benefit of the department or college, such as advising a student organization, participating in academic events, engaging with students, and/or serving on departmental or college committees as needed.

Research: While the primary focus is instructional, the College provides a supportive environment for scholarly activity to publish in high-quality academic journals in finance or other related areas. The College maintains subscriptions to several major databases through the WRDS platform.

Kansas State University is located in Manhattan, KS, in the rolling Flint Hills, approximately 100 miles west of Kansas City. Manhattan has a population of over 53,000 residents, and student enrollment at KSU is nearly 22,000 students. The surrounding area offers excellent opportunities for outdoor activities, including camping, boating, hunting, fishing, hiking, and biking. Mainly due to the university's influence, cultural and sporting events are at a level of frequency and quality unheard of by most cities this size. Furthermore, Manhattan offers affordable housing, robust elementary, middle, and high school programs, and a crime rate that is half the national average. In short, Manhattan offers a variety of urban amenities yet retains the best qualities of a small university town. For more information, visit our website at cba.ksu.edu.
